이 안내서는 SPI 프로토콜을 사용하여 Arduino UNO와 인터페이스하기위한 최고의 제품에 대한 자세한 개요를 제공합니다. 사용 편의성, 기능 및 비용 효율성과 같은 요소를 고려하여 프로젝트에 대한 완벽한 솔루션을 선택하는 데 도움이되는 다양한 옵션을 탐색합니다. 우리는 또한 완전히 이해하기 위해 SPI 커뮤니케이션의 기술적 측면을 조사합니다.
SPI (Serial Peripheral Interface)는 짧은 거리 통신에 사용되는 동기식 전이중 통신 버스로, 주로 Arduino UNO와 같은 마이크로 컨트롤러를 주변 장치에 연결하는 데 사용됩니다. 속도와 단순성으로 유명합니다. 그만큼 Arduino UNO SPI 인터페이스 Mosi (Master Out Slave In), MISO (Mas
SPI는 고속 및 여러 슬레이브 장치를 동시에 처리하는 기능을 포함하여 I2C와 같은 다른 통신 프로토콜에 비해 장점을 제공합니다. 따라서 고속 센서, 디스플레이 및 기타 주변 장치와 인터페이스와 같은 빠른 데이터 전송이 필요한 응용 프로그램에 이상적입니다. 그러나 다른 방법보다 더 신중한 핀 할당이 필요합니다.
올바른 SPI 인터페이스 제품을 선택하는 것은 특정 요구에 크게 좌우됩니다. 다음은 명확성을 위해 분류 된 몇 가지 예입니다. 구매하기 전에 항상 자세한 사양에 대한 데이터 시트에 문의하십시오.
ILI9341 기반 TFT LCD 디스플레이는 고해상도와 생생한 색상에 대한 인기있는 선택입니다. 그들은 Arduino 라이브러리에서 널리 사용 가능하며 잘 지원됩니다. 크기와 해상도에는 많은 변형이 있습니다. SPI 인터페이스를 사용하면 빠른 이미지 렌더링이 가능하여 그래픽 사용자 인터페이스 (GUI) 및 데이터 시각화 프로젝트에 적합합니다. 이 디스플레이는 종종 특정 디스플레이의 로직 전압에 따라 레벨 이동이 필요합니다. 적절한 레벨 시프터 IC가 필요할 수 있습니다.
또 다른 우수한 옵션 인 ST7735 디스플레이는 해상도, 색 깊이 및 비용 효율성의 균형을 제공합니다. 또한 비교적 작은 발자국을 자랑하여 우주 구조 프로젝트에 적합합니다. ILI9341과 마찬가지로 SPI 프로토콜을 사용하여 통신을 사용하며 사양에 따라 레벨 이동이 필요할 수 있습니다.
특징 | ILI9341 | ST7735 |
---|---|---|
해상도 (공통) | 320x240 | 128x160, 128x128 |
색 깊이 | 16 비트 (65k 색상) | 16 비트 (65k 색상) |
비용 | 보통의 | 일반적으로 낮습니다 |
정확한 온도 측정을 위해 Max31865는 신뢰할 수있는 선택입니다. 이 IC는 열전대 전압을 정확하게 읽고 온도 판독 값으로 변환합니다. SPI 인터페이스를 사용하면 Arduino Uno와 쉽게 통합 할 수 있습니다. 정확한 온도 데이터가 필요한 산업 및 과학 응용 프로그램에 종종 사용됩니다. 선택한 열전대 유형과의 호환성을 확인하려면 항상 데이터 시트를 참조하십시오.
MFRC522는 커뮤니케이션을 위해 SPI를 사용하는 인기있는 RFID (무선 주파수 식별) 리더 모듈입니다. RFID 태그에 데이터를 읽고 쓰는 데 사용하여 액세스 제어, 인벤토리 관리 및 기타 응용 프로그램에 적합합니다. 이 모듈에는 Arduino 작동을위한 특정 라이브러리가 필요합니다.
선택의 선택 최고의 Arduino UNO SPI 인터페이스 제품 프로젝트의 구체적인 요구 사항에 달려 있습니다. 다음 요소를 고려하십시오.
이러한 요소를 신중하게 평가하고 다양한 제품의 사양을 조사함으로써 Arduino UNO 프로젝트에 가장 적합한 SPI 인터페이스를 선택할 수 있습니다.
프로젝트를위한 고품질 LCD 디스플레이의 경우 사용할 수있는 옵션을 살펴보십시오. Dalian Eastern Display Co., Ltd. 다양한 디스플레이 솔루션을 제공합니다.
1 특정 구성 요소에 대한 데이터 시트는 자세한 사양 및 응용 프로그램 노트를 위해 문의해야합니다.
제쳐두고>